Columbia Point, Boston, MA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Columbia Point?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Columbia Point Studio Apartments | $2,482 | $2,125 | $3,097 |
| Columbia Point 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,860 | $1,160 | $8,011 |
| Columbia Point 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,487 | $2,000 | $6,863 |
| Columbia Point 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,602 | $2,100 | $7,773 |
| Columbia Point 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,270 | $2,900 | $7,200 |
| Columbia Point 5 Bedroom Apartments | $5,167 | $1,525 | $7,000 |
| Columbia Point 6 Bedroom Apartments | $6,317 | $5,400 | $7,800 |
